The Sooners exploded in the third inning against Duke on Thursday to notch their first victory at the 2024 WCWS.
That’s all it took for Oklahoma to completely change the complexion of Thursday’s Women’s College World Series contest against Duke.Twenty-three pitches later, the Sooners had bashed a pair of two-run bombs and Devon Park was rocking, fueled by the horde of crimson-clad fans cheering on the local outfit.But the Sooners don’t have to have big moments. They can seize on any glimpse of good fortune to bury an opponent., said.
Coleman made another highlight play in the outfield to rob Duke of at least two runs in the third inning.prevented a baserunner from going from first to third with a nice defensive play at first in the fifth inning.And once the Sooners steal momentum — especially in Oklahoma City — they rarely give it back.
“… We can create momentum off of any little thing. It's not like hitting or fielding. It's kind of both, everything.”
